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 09-04-2018 13:28:52

seb95
Membre
Distrib. : openSUSE Leap et Tumbleweed
(G)UI : GNOME, Xfce et KDE
Inscription : 19-02-2017
Site Web

[packaging] J'échoue lors de l'envois vers mentors.debian

Bonjour, j'ai suivi les différentes docs (parsemés et un peu labyrinthe), mais voila, j'ai suivi la doc sur dput, https://debian-facile.org/doc:mentors:dput j'ai donc un fichier .dput.cf avec ceci:

[mentors]
fqdn = mentors.debian.net
incoming = /upload
method = http
allow_unsigned_uploads = 0
progress_indicator = 2
# Allow uploads for UNRELEASED packages
allowed_distributions = .*
 



Donc j'ai envoyé avec ceci:

dput mentors /home/sebastien/Paquets/ghostwriter/ghostwriter_1.6.0-0~bpo9+1_amd64.changes



Checking signature on .changes
gpg: /home/sebastien/Paquets/ghostwriter/ghostwriter_1.6.0-0~bpo9+1_amd64.changes: Valid signature from XXXXXXXXX
Checking signature on .dsc
gpg: /home/sebastien/Paquets/ghostwriter/ghostwriter_1.6.0-0~bpo9+1.dsc: Valid signature from XXXXXXXXX
Package includes an .orig.tar.gz file although the debian revision suggests
that it might not be required. Multiple uploads of the .orig.tar.gz may be
rejected by the upload queue management software.
Uploading to mentors (via http to mentors.debian.net):
  Uploading ghostwriter_1.6.0-0~bpo9+1.dsc: Upload failed: 301 Moved Permanently



Peut etre lié au fait que c'est en HTTPS maintenant:

How to upload packages to mentors.debian.net?

You need to use dput to upload packages. We accept your uploads through HTTPS or FTP. All packages must be signed with the GnuPG key you configured in your control panel.
HTTPS uploads     FTP uploads

To use HTTPS put the following content to your ~/.dput.cf file:

[mentors]
fqdn = mentors.debian.net
incoming = /upload
method = https
allow_unsigned_uploads = 0
progress_indicator = 2
# Allow uploads for UNRELEASED packages
allowed_distributions = .*

   

You can use FTP to upload packages to Mentors. If you prefer that method make sure you sign your uploads with your GPG key! This is the corresponding ~/.dput.cf file:

[mentors-ftp]
fqdn = mentors.debian.net
login = anonymous
progress_indicator = 2
passive_ftp = 1
incoming = /pub/UploadQueue/
method = ftp
allow_unsigned_uploads = 0
# Allow uploads for UNRELEASED packages
allowed_distributions = .*

Once you have it set up, you can run it from your shell like this:

$ dput mentors your_sourcepackage_1.0.changes

If you did everything right, you will get a confirmation mail from our site and you can start seeking a sponsor for your package.



J'ai donc modifié la doc en ajoutant un s dans http.

Dernière modification par seb95 (09-04-2018 13:31:32)

Hors ligne

#2 09-04-2018 13:33:32

seb95
Membre
Distrib. : openSUSE Leap et Tumbleweed
(G)UI : GNOME, Xfce et KDE
Inscription : 19-02-2017
Site Web

Re : [packaging] J'échoue lors de l'envois vers mentors.debian

Cette fois ça m'a l'air d'etre bon :

dput mentors /home/sebastien/Paquets/ghostwriter/ghostwriter_1.6.0-0~bpo9+1_amd64.changes



Checking signature on .changes
gpg: /home/sebastien/Paquets/ghostwriter/ghostwriter_1.6.0-0~bpo9+1_amd64.changes: Valid signature from XXXXXXXX
Checking signature on .dsc
gpg: /home/sebastien/Paquets/ghostwriter/ghostwriter_1.6.0-0~bpo9+1.dsc: Valid signature from XXXXXXXXX
Package includes an .orig.tar.gz file although the debian revision suggests
that it might not be required. Multiple uploads of the .orig.tar.gz may be
rejected by the upload queue management software.
Uploading to mentors (via https to mentors.debian.net):
  Uploading ghostwriter_1.6.0-0~bpo9+1.dsc: done.
  Uploading ghostwriter_1.6.0.orig.tar.gz: done.    
  Uploading ghostwriter_1.6.0-0~bpo9+1.debian.tar.xz: done.
  Uploading ghostwriter-dbgsym_1.6.0-0~bpo9+1_amd64.deb: done.      
  Uploading ghostwriter_1.6.0-0~bpo9+1_amd64.buildinfo: done.  
  Uploading ghostwriter_1.6.0-0~bpo9+1_amd64.deb: done.    
  Uploading ghostwriter_1.6.0-0~bpo9+1_amd64.changes: done.
Successfully uploaded packages.
 



Mais rien ne s'affiche chez mentors dans my packages, est ce normale?

Dernière modification par seb95 (09-04-2018 13:35:30)

Hors ligne

#3 09-04-2018 15:47:02

seb95
Membre
Distrib. : openSUSE Leap et Tumbleweed
(G)UI : GNOME, Xfce et KDE
Inscription : 19-02-2017
Site Web

Re : [packaging] J'échoue lors de l'envois vers mentors.debian

J'ai trouvé le soucis, c'est que quand je fais un debuild et autre manoeuvre pour faire des paquets, les devscripts donne comme mail mon users avec @nom de la machine, ce qui n'est bien entendu pas ce que je veux!
Du coup le changelog est pas avec le bon mail ni les autres fichiers, comment je peux changer l'adresse dans les outils de contructions de paquets et y mettre celle voulu?

Sinon le paquet ou plutôt la demande est là:
https://mentors.debian.net/package/ghostwriter

Dernière modification par seb95 (09-04-2018 17:15:07)

Hors ligne

Pied de page des forums